Description
The Midlands Districts Insurance Consortium consist of 8 District Councils from across Worcestershire, Staffordshire and Derbyshire who are carrying out a joint tender for insurances which will include (but not limited to) Property Damage (including Material Damage, Business Interruption, Contract Works/Works in Progress, Money, and All Risks), Terrorism, Casualty (including Employers Liability, Public/Products Liability, Officials Indemnity, Professional Indemnity, Libel & Slander and Public Health), Fidelity Guarantee/Crime, Motor Fleet and Uninsured Loss Recovery, Personal Accident/Travel, Engineering Insurance and Computers.
The 8 Councils have a common renewal date of the 1st July 2019 but have separate polices with different perils, limits of indemnity and excess.
Contracts for each Lot will be evaluated as a Consortium and the Award for each Lot will be made to the Most Economically Advantageous Bid for each Lot against the Award criteria. In addition to conventional insurance approach, the Consortium will also be seeking bids on a non-conventional pooled basis.
